PHP定义表.字段名

PHP定义表.字段名,php,Php,我有这样一个问题: SELECT username ... $username = $row['username']; SELECT a.username, ... 通常情况下,选择过程如下所示: SELECT username ... $username = $row['username']; SELECT a.username, ... 我会这样设置一个变量: SELECT username ... $username = $row['username']; SELECT a

我有这样一个问题:

SELECT username ...
$username = $row['username'];
SELECT a.username, ...
通常情况下,选择过程如下所示:

SELECT username ...
$username = $row['username'];
SELECT a.username, ...
我会这样设置一个变量:

SELECT username ...
$username = $row['username'];
SELECT a.username, ...
我的问题是它是这样的:

SELECT username ...
$username = $row['username'];
SELECT a.username, ...
所以我试过:

$username = $row['a.username']; 
但这是行不通的。。在这种情况下,正确的方法是什么?

试试看

"SELECT a.username, ... WHERE a.username = '" . $row['username'] .'";

这就是SQL语法的第一天。以同样的方式仔细查看

$row['username']
var\u dump($row)以查找。。。(但仍然是
$row['username']